Beverly - Michael E. Brien, 75, passed away on February 9, 2026, in the Kaplan Family Hospice House. He was the husband of Susan (Harris) Brien, with whom he shared nearly 40 years of marriage.

Born in Malden on June 5, 1950, he was the son of the late Alfred and Jean (Coughlin) Brien. Michael had a successful career as a salesman with Pepperidge Farm. He also worked at the former Middleton Golf Course for over 20 years and upon retirement from Pepperidge Farm, he worked at the Thomson Golf Club in North Reading.

Michael was an avid golfer; his thirst for adventure led him to enjoy water skiing, scuba diving and flying hot air balloons. Sunday afternoons in the fall you would find him in his easy chair, a glass of his homemade wine nearby as he cheered on the New England Patriots. A kind, generous, thoughtful neighbor, he frequently mowed their lawns and cleared snow from their driveways, expecting nothing in return. His own lawn was lush, meticulously maintained, his pride and joy and envied by many.

He especially enjoyed trips to Disney World and Disney cruises with his family.

In addition to his wife Susan, he is survived by his children Joshua Brien of Boscawen, NH, Amanda Brien of Nashua NH and Heather Brien and her husband Ali of Orlando, FL, his three grandchildren, Caden, Dylan and Camdon and his sisters, Sandy Brien of NH, Nancy Szwyd of NH and Christine Golden of FL. He was predeceased by his daughter Melissa Brien.
